Does homeowners insurance cover house leveling in Thousand Oaks, California?
Homeowners insurance usually does not cover foundation repair or leveling unless the damage is caused by a covered peril like a sudden plumbing leak or certain natural disasters. Review your policy or speak with your insurance agent in Thousand Oaks to understand your coverage.
